Update 7/29/19: In the first iteration, there is an issue where the filament may not fully compress the switch resulting in the printer reporting a "temp too low" message. Basically, it was missing filament. I updated the design slightly to allow for more compression on the switch to fix this (hopefully). This is a filament sensor mount/housing I designed to work in conjunction with the Petsfang E3D v6 Hotend and Titan Direct Extruder setup, but I am betting it could be used other places. I am using this with my filament mounted on the top of the printer. This mount positions the CR10(s) sensor directly above the E3D Titan extruder input and significantly reduces the "waste" filament at the end of a run. The sensor wire lead can be run along the wire bundle for the thermistor, heating element, fans, etc., but you may need to extend the wire a bit to make this work. This was designed to "slide" between the Titan Extruder requiring only the top 2 bolts to be removed (and the bottom one(s) loosened). It requires M3x16 flathead screws to mount the sensor housing to the arm, and the M3 screws used to mount the extruder to the stepper will probably need to be longer by about 4mm (I used the longer bolts provided by th3dstudio), and you will probably need to adjust the pinion on the stepper.
